With a decade of experience as a dedicated primary and secondary teacher and artist, Will Burrows brings his passion for education and creativity into the realm of stained glass artistry. Will's journey from the classroom to the studio has been driven by his deep-rooted love for nurturing artistic talents.
As a part-time artist throughout his teaching career, Will cultivated his skills and discovered a profound connection with the world of stained glass. Now, he has taken the leap to fully embrace his artistic calling.
Today, Will is dedicated to sharing the art of stained glass through courses and workshops. His background in education, combined with his artistic prowess, ensures that every course attendee is well looked after. Will's caring and patient approach, honed from years of teaching, creates an environment where creativity flourishes, and individuals of all skill levels can explore the beauty of stained glass.
